FIRST WORLD WAR PHOTOGRAPHERS
object description: An American official photographer of the US Signal Corps and his assistant carry out reconnaissance photography under cover of a deep river bank by the River Aire on the Western Front. They are using a glass plate camera mounted on a tripod to photograph the German lines.
